A chimney sweep will do a thorough chimney cleaning to get rid of any kind of deposits, residue, creosote, as well as blockages from the chimney. Filthy, damaged deteriorating, and blocked chimneys create injuries and fires yearly. If you use you fireplace or wood burning stove, the National Fire Protection Association recommends having your chimney inspected and also swept once a year in order to protect against fires.

What does a chimney sweep do?

A chimney service professional will perform a complete cleaning of your chimney. Cleaning logs are truly not effective and also are not advised. They will not get all the soot and creosote build-up out of the chimney like hand cleaning.

Step 1: Protecting

To start, a cleaning specialist will protect the inside of your home by spreading out tarps over the space, floor, and hearth. They will cover the fire place with vinyl sheeting, inserting an commercial vacuum hose pipe right into the fireplace, and will then tape and also seal off the fire place. They'll connect extension pipes and run them to the industrial vacuum cleaner with a fine micron filter which rests outside. This will trap the fine residue, creosote, and other dirt later on.

Step 2: Sweeping

Next off, they will clean the whole chimney with hand held brushes, as well as brushes with extension rods. Generally they will start at the top of the chimney and work downward, meticulously cleaning all the surfaces. Your chimney sweep will clean the flue, the damper, the smoke chamber, the smoke shelf, and the firebox.

Step 3: Tidy up

They will after that peel back a little area of the plastic sheet and use a range of brushes inside. Following this, everything will be vacuumed and also cleaned. The vinyl sheeting and tarps will be moved outside, cleaned off and put away.

What exactly is creosote?

Creosote is a brown, oily, tar-like compound which forms from burning wood or coal. It starts as a loose, feathery accumulation which initially can be brushed away easily. As it builds up more, it ends up being tar-like, and is harder to get rid of, in some cases requiring the use of scrapers to remove it. If left uncleaned, and even more layers develop, the creosote hardens.

When a fire is burned in the fireplace or wood stove, the smoke becomes extremely hot. Hardened creosote can start to drip and melt like wax. When the build up of creosote is extremely heavy, it limits the air flow via the chimney flue. The restricted air circulation causes creosote to accumulate even quicker.

Is creosote unsafe?

Creosote is hazardous in a number of various ways. It's toxic and dangerous for your health and wellness, and it places your home at risk of fires.

Carbon monoxide gas

Creosote build up creates decreased air flow and this can enable carbon monoxide to build up inside your residence while a fire is burning. Carbon monoxide gas is an odorless and colorless gas which can trigger flu-like symptoms, and can even lead to death.

Creosote Toxicity

Besides the carbon monoxide accumulation, creosote itself is poisonous. It could trigger irritated skin and eyes, respiratory issues, and is carcinogenic (cancer triggering).

Fire Risk

The most unsafe thing about creosote is that it is exceptionally flammable. It's the most typical cause of chimney fires. While chimneys are made to endure a high level of heat, the strength of a chimney fire can promptly exceed this degree.

Just how often should my chimney be cleaned?

Just how frequently a chimney must be cleaned depends of just how often you use it and what materials you burn inside. Gas burning fireplaces should be examined every year. Although they burn cleaner, moisture, particles, cracks and various other problems can develop which can permit carbon monoxide to enter the residence.

Oil burning flues should be cleaned annually to prevent soot from developing.

Due to the fact that wood burning fire places and stoves create even more residue and creosote, they need to be swept a lot more often. A great rule of thumb is to have your chimney swept after a cord of wood has been burned within.
